Incorporated in 1651, Eastham is known today as the gateway to the Cape Cod National Seashore, founded in 1961 by President John F.Kennedy to protect Cape Cod's coast from erosion an over-population. The town has many beaches both on the Atlantic and bay sides, as well as Nauset Light and the Three
sisters Lighthouses.
